My client, a world leading manufacturer who operates mainly within the defence sector, is seeking a business development manager to join their team. This is a fantastic opportunity to join the business at an exciting time of growth, allowing you some real scope for development in the role. You will have 3-5 years’ experience working in business development within the defence sector, ideally in a manufacturing environment. Experience operating within Land systems, armoured vehicles, tactical platforms, or related environments would be hugely beneficial. My client will also consider former service people (NCO, junior officers etc) who have knowledge of defence procurement. This role can be based anywhere in the UK; however, you will be required to be in the office in the North East during the onboarding process. This role will also require UK and international travel 10-15% of the time.

Duties and responsibilities:

  • Identify and qualify new Land platform, vehicle, and systems integration opportunities globally.
  • Develop early engagement strategies with OEMs, system integrators, primes, and MOD customers.
  • Build and maintain a robust Land sales pipeline aligned to strategic growth objectives.
  • Shape customer requirements where possible to align with business capabilities.
  • Lead bid/no-bid assessments and initiate capture plans for strategic pursuits.
  • Secure contracts.
  • Grow revenue within established Land accounts through cross‑selling and up‑selling COTS, MOTS, and bespoke solutions.
  • Maintain structured account development plans for key customers.
  • Monitor programme lifecycles to identify upgrade, retrofit, and sustainment opportunities.
  • Strengthen relationships across the buying committee within customer organisations.
  • Develop pricing strategies in collaboration with Finance and Commercial teams.
  • Support negotiation of commercial terms in alignment with internal governance.
  • Ensure awareness of procurement regulations and contractual obligations relevant to Land programmes.
  • Work closely with the Contracts & Compliance Manager to ensure regulatory alignment.
  • Lead early‑stage capture planning and win strategy development.
  • Provide customer insight and commercial positioning to the Bid & Proposals Manager.
  • Support key customer presentations, clarifications, and negotiation meetings.
  • Maintain awareness of global Land Defence trends, procurement cycles, and competitor positioning.
  • Contribute to Defence growth strategy and long‑range opportunity planning.
  • Represent the business at relevant trade exhibitions and industry forums.
